Crown Crafts introduces Nautica juvenile collection

Jane Kitchen -- Kids Today, 6/1/2005

Orlando, Fla.— Textile manufacturer Crown Crafts showed its new line of Nautica juvenile bedding here at the Juvenile Products Manufacturers Assn. trade show last month. The collection is made up of both infant and youth bedding, with two girl and two boy sets for both categories.

Benjamin and Ryan were shown on the infant boys' side. Ryan features an Americana palette of red, navy and ecru, and includes plaid, solid and cable-knit patchwork. Benjamin is a softer blue and yellow group and also features cable-knit patterns. On the girls' side, Nicole and Chloe were shown in the crib bedding groups. Nicole includes soft pink and lavender colors, while Chloe features shades of pink and green in floral and stripes. Four-piece crib sets will retail for $229 and will ship in September.

On the youth side, Taylor and Peyton were shown in the boys groups. Peyton has a subtle sports theme and includes a navy comforter with bold orange stripes, while Taylor includes shades of red, green, yellow and navy in geometric shapes and stripes. On the girls' side, Caitlin was shown with stripes in shades of melon, yellow and pink, along with dec pillows featuring flowers and dragonflies, while Penelope features pale green and blue patchwork along with pink paisley.

Crown Crafts also showed several other new licensed patterns, including new Pooh patterns, Puppy Scooby Doo, Little Golden Books, NASCAR baby, Build-A-Bear, Holly Hobbie baby and Sue Dreamer.

The Ryan crib group is part of Crown Crafts' new Nautica line.
